Boosting Confidence and Overcoming Business Challenges with Affirmations

As you face the daily hurdles of business ownership, cultivating a strong mindset is crucial. One effective technique is to repeat affirmations, which can help create a deliberate pause before reacting to stressful situations. Katie Ferro suggests saying an affirmation twice, allowing you to reset your thoughts and approach challenges with clarity.

Research supports the idea that self-affirmation can enhance problem-solving under stress. A study published in PLOS ONE in 2013 by Creswell and colleagues found that self-affirmation may help you tackle problems more effectively. Additionally, the 2014 research by Kross and colleagues highlights that the way you speak to yourself matters, influencing your overall mindset.

When negative thoughts creep in, consider using credible statements like, “I can take the next useful step.” This shift can empower you to overcome doubts and frame setbacks as opportunities for growth. Remember, persistent anxiety or burnout should be addressed with support from a qualified mental health professional.

Practical Steps to Integrate Affirmations into Your Daily Routine

Creating a routine around your daily affirmations can transform your approach to business. By establishing simple rituals, you can reinforce a positive mindset that leads to success.

Start by building a 21-day routine based on Katie Ferro’s recommendation. Choose three statements that address a current business priority. For example, you might say, “My mind is clear, my focus is sharp, and my actions are purposeful.”

Here are some practical steps to consider:

  • In the morning, pair spoken affirmations with a concrete task, like contacting a client or reviewing sales figures.
  • For a midday reset, read a phone wallpaper or journal entry before tackling difficult decisions or money questions.
  • At night, reflect on the actions you took, what you learned, and how your thoughts evolved.

Listening to Katie Ferro’s Episode 157 can provide a guided format for your practice. Remember, consistency is key. A brief, two-minute practice each day can be more effective than an elaborate ritual.

Lastly, if any statements feel unrealistic, don’t hesitate to revise them. Your journey is about growth, and it’s okay to seek practical support alongside your affirmations.

Real-Life Success Stories and the Affirmation Journey

Belief in one’s potential can be a powerful catalyst for change. History shows us that when individuals embrace ambitious ideas, they can achieve remarkable feats. Steve Jobs, co-founder of Apple Inc., once said,

“The people who are crazy enough to think they can change the world are the ones who do.”

This highlights how conviction, paired with execution and teamwork, can lead to groundbreaking innovations.

Another inspiring example is Roger Bannister, who became the first person to run a mile in under four minutes in 1954. His achievement shattered perceived limits and inspired over 1,000 runners to break his record in the decades that followed. This demonstrates how one person’s success can elevate collective expectations.

Figures like Eckhart Tolle and Les Brown emphasize the importance of maintaining a constructive mindset throughout their journeys. They illustrate that while positive thinking is valuable, it must be coupled with disciplined action to create real change.

These stories remind us that affirmations alone do not guarantee success. Instead, they serve as a tool to reinforce belief and motivate action. Consider identifying one belief that supports your next step and one practical behavior that will help you test or strengthen it.
